Dainty and feminine, isn't it? Just sweet. I cut another panel and layered it, then layered that over a panel of BasicGrey Euphoria paper (quite old). I think the small flowery print looks pretty peeking through the negative cut. The blue panel it rests on is from the same Euphoria pad, and I cut the sentiment from that blue as well. Before cutting the sentiment I glued the designer paper onto a heavy white cardstock so it would be easier to work with, as well as having a bit more dimension.
To finish, I punched 1/8" cardstock circles with a hole punch, placed them as shown, and coated with JudiKins Diamond Glaze.
